Mohanlal, a renowned actor in Malayalam Cinema, was born on May 21st, 1960, in the Pathanamthitta district of Kerala, a state located in the southern part of India.
Born to Viswanathan Nair and Santhakumari, he embarked on his acting journey with a classic villain role, eventually becoming one of the most outstanding actors in the Indian film industry.

Throughout his illustrious career, Mohanlal has received numerous accolades, including the nation's highest civilian honors, "Padma Shri" and "Padma Bhushan". He has also won five National Film Awards, including Best Actor twice for Bharatham (1991) and Vaanaprastham (1999),as well as numerous other awards and honors.
